Basic Characteristics of an ACT Team
Multidisciplinary medical team: The responsibility for treatment, support and rehabilitation is shared among the members of the team. There are certain distinct roles (such as the team co-ordinator and the psychiatrist); however, responsibility is shared among the members of the team.
Continuity in the provision of services by the entire ACT team.
Team approach techniques: The Assertive Community Treatment model has been criticised for the level of pressure/“coercion” exercised on patient with the aim to commit them to the treatment.
